Output 76e6283704f1a23b32ff04f346edc3bb85ecafbfcd894ee804f26e0a3e09cb69:1

value
11438894
script pubkey
OP_0 OP_PUSHBYTES_20 b68c37596b08367c8f6668845e4a9f1de8327927
address
ltc1qk6xrwkttpqm8ermxdzz9uj5lrh5ry7f8ae8lzs
transaction
76e6283704f1a23b32ff04f346edc3bb85ecafbfcd894ee804f26e0a3e09cb69
spent
true